PRELIMINARY ANNOUNCEMENT

AUSTRALIAN TRANSPUTER AND OCCAM USER GROUP
CONFERENCE & EXHIBITION

6 & 7 JULY 1989

GLASSHOUSE THEATRE
ROYAL MELBOURNE INSTITUTE OF TECHNOLOGY
124 La Trobe Street
MELBOURNE AUSTRALIA

In  conjunction  with  the  Centre  for  Advanced  Technology  in 
Telecommunications  within  the Department of  Communication  and 
Electrical  Engineering  at  the  Royal  Melbourne  Institute  of 
Technology,   the  second  Conference  and  Exhibition   of   the 
Australian  Transputer and OCCAM User Group will be held  at  the 
Royal  Melbourne  Institute  of Technology.  The  Conference  and 
Exhibition  will  provide an opportunity to focus on  the  latest 
research   and  developments  in  transputers,   transputer-based 
technology  and applications using transputers in the  Australian 
environment.

AUSTRALIAN TRANSPUTER AND OCCAM USER GROUP CONFERENCE & EXHIBITION

28 & 29 JUNE 1990

HOTEL LAWSON
383-389 Bulwara Road
ULTIMO 2007 AUSTRALIA

Following  on  from the previous successful Conferences  held  in 
Melbourne, the Australian Transputer and OCCAM User Group will be 
conducting  a Conference/Exhibition in Sydney under the  auspices 
of  the  Key  Centre  for  Advanced  Computing  Sciences  at  the 
University  of  Technology, Sydney and the  Centre  for  Advanced 
Technology   in  Telecommunications  within  the  Department   of 
Communication  and Electrical Engineering at the Royal  Melbourne 
Institute  of  Technology.  The Conference  and  Exhibition  will 
provide  an  opportunity  to focus on  the  latest  research  and 
developments  in  transputers,  transputer-based  technology  and 
applications using transputers in the Australian environment.

KEYNOTE SPEAKER

The  keynote speaker for this year's Conference will be  Dr  Iann 
Barron, a distinguished computer scientist who was one of the co-
inventors  of the transputer, and a founder of the company  INMOS 
which developed the transputer in Bristol, U.K.
